Warning Signs You Need Residential Water Removal
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ent potential health hazards. Look out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ice musty smells in your home, it’s essential to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source of the odor and provide a solution.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ice changes in your flooring,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Stains on Walls or Ceilings
Stains on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ice stains,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ause and provide a solution.
Water Stains on Ceiling Tiles
Water stains on ceiling tiles can be a sign of water damage. If you notice stains,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. If you notice peeling,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ause and provide a solution.
Discolored or Fuzzy Carpeting
Discolored or fuzzy carpeting can be a sign of water damage. If you notice changes in your carpeting,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Residential Water Removal Cost In Boiling Springs, NC
The cost of Residential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Boiling Springs, NC. Our team will work with you to create a customized plan and prov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ved. Here are some estimated price ranges for common Residential Water Removal services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Structural dr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Content c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Equipment rental and usage |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Disinfecting and deodorizing |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Reconstruction and repair | $1,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
